Al Gore: The greatest environmental hustler? Posted: 14 Dec 2010 10:59 AM PST ![]() The subject of the environment has long been a political football. Many manipulators have used it to gain power, thwart power or to save the world from something that isn't quite clear. Global warming; global cooling, cancers, flooding, droughts, etc. causes questions and worries about what is going on and how we can bring it under control. The first major politician to finesse this issue was the late President Richard M. Nixon. He elevated the Environmental Protection Agency and started "Earth Day" as a mechanism to divert attention from the anti-war and the civil rights movements that were whirling from Vietnam/Cambodia and the recent assassination of Dr. Martin Luther King. Before long, more than a few politicians saw the advantage of embracing the issue and rallying the masses for political gain. |
